Outlander Reliability: What the Reviews Say
Consumer Reports and Expert Opinions
Consumer Reports, a respected source for vehicle reliability ratings, provides valuable insights into the Outlander's performance. Historically, the Outlander has received mixed reviews concerning reliability. While some model years have been praised for their durability, others have faced criticism for mechanical issues. According to recent data, the Outlander's reliability scores have improved in recent years. The vehicle's drivetrain and engine performance, in particular, have been highlighted as areas of improvement.
Owner Testimonials
Owner testimonials offer a real-world perspective on the Outlander's reliability. Many drivers commend the vehicle for its longevity and minimal maintenance requirements. However, some owners have reported issues with the electrical system and interior components.

Tips for Maintaining Your Outlander's Reliability
Maintaining your Outlander is key to ensuring its longevity and reliability. Here are some tips to keep your vehicle in top condition: Regular Servicing: Adhering to the manufacturer's recommended service schedule can prevent many common issues. Stay Updated on Recalls: Keeping track of any recalls and ensuring they are addressed can prevent potential problems. Monitor Fluid Levels: Regularly checking and topping up essential fluids, such as oil and coolant, can prevent engine-related issues. Tire Maintenance: Proper tire inflation and regular rotations can improve handling and extend the life of your tires.
